A chimney sweep will certainly do a extensive chimney cleaning to remove any deposits, soot, creosote, and also obstructions from the chimney. Dirty, damaged deteriorating, and obstructed chimneys cause injuries as well as fires every year. If you use you fireplace or wood burning stove, the National Fire Protection Association suggests having your chimney inspected and also swept every year in order to protect against fires.

What does a chimney sweep do?

A chimney service professional will perform a full cleaning of your chimney. Cleaning logs are really ineffective and are not recommended. They will not remove all the soot and creosote build-up out of the chimney like hand cleaning.

Step 1: Safeguarding

To start, a cleaning specialist will shield the inside of your house by spreading tarps over the room, floor, and fireplace. They will cover the fireplace with plastic sheeting, placing an commercial vacuum pipe into the fireplace, and will after that tape and also seal off the fireplace. They'll connect extension hoses and run them to the industrial vacuum cleaner with a fine micron filter which sits outside. This will catch the fine soot, creosote, and other dirt later.

Step 2: Sweeping

Next off, they will brush the whole chimney with hand held brushes, and brushes with extension rods. Normally they will start on top of the smokeshaft and work downward, meticulously brushing all the surface areas. Your chimney sweep will clean the flue, the damper, the smoke chamber, the smoke shelf, and the firebox.

Step 3: Clean Up

They will after that peel back a tiny area of the vinyl sheeting and use a range of brushes inside. Following this, everything will be vacuumed and cleaned. The vinyl sheet and tarps will be relocated outside, cleared off and put away.

What exactly is creosote?

Creosote is a brown, oily, tar-like compound which forms from burning wood or coal. It starts as a loose, feathery accumulation which at first can be brushed away easily. As it builds up much more, it comes to be tar-like, and is more difficult to remove, in some cases requiring the use of scrapers to remove it. If left uncleaned, and even more layers develop, the creosote solidifies.

When a fire is burned in the fireplace or wood stove, the smoke comes to be very hot. Solidified creosote can start to drip and melt like wax. When the build up of creosote is extremely hefty, it limits the air flow through the chimney flue. The restricted air circulation causes creosote to build up even faster.

Is creosote dangerous?

Creosote is harmful in a number of various ways. It's toxic and unsafe for your health and wellness, and it puts your home in danger of fires.

Carbon monoxide gas

Creosote accumulation causes decreased air movement and this can enable carbon monoxide to develop inside your house while a fire is burning. Carbon monoxide is an odorless and also colorless gas which can cause flu-like symptoms, and can also lead to death.

Creosote Toxicity

Besides the carbon monoxide accumulation, creosote itself is poisonous. It could trigger inflamed skin and eyes, breathing issues, and is carcinogenic (cancer creating).

Fire Risk

The most hazardous thing about creosote is that it is extremely flammable. It's the most usual cause of chimney fires. While chimneys are made to hold up against a high degree of heat, the strength of a chimney fire can promptly surpass this degree.

How often should my chimney be cleaned?

Just how often a chimney needs to be cleaned depends of exactly how often you use it and also what materials you burn inside. Gas burning fire places need to be checked on a yearly basis. Although they burn cleaner, dampness, debris, fractures and other concerns can develop which can allow carbon monoxide to get into the house.

Oil burning flues need to be cleaned annually to keep residue from building up.

Because wood burning fireplaces and stoves create even more soot and creosote, they should be swept more often. A great general rule is to have your chimney swept after a cord of wood has been burned within.
